Sheet roofing installation services involve the placement of durable, weather-resistant panels made from materials such as metal, asphalt, or composite sheets. This process typically includes preparing the existing roof surface, measuring and cutting the sheets to fit specific architectural designs, and securely fastening them to ensure long-lasting protection. Professionals may also incorporate additional elements like flashing, sealants, and insulation to enhance the roof's performance and longevity. Proper installation ensures that the roofing system effectively shields the property from elements such as rain, snow, and wind, helping to maintain the structural integrity of the building.
One of the primary issues sheet roofing installation addresses is roof deterioration caused by age, weather exposure, or previous damage. Over time, roofs can develop leaks, cracks, or weakened areas that compromise the building’s interior. Installing new sheet roofing can resolve these problems by providing a fresh, resilient barrier against water intrusion and environmental stressors. Additionally, it can improve energ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er, especially when insulated or reflective materials are used. This service is often sought after during roof replacement projects or when upgrading older roofing systems to meet current standards.

Material Costs - The cost of sheet roofing materials typ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type and quality of the material chosen. For a standard 1,500-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from approximately $4,500 to $15,000.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on the selected materials.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$1.50 and $3.50 per square foot, with total labor costs for an average-sized roof falling between $2,250 and $5,250. These rates may fluctuate based on the complexity of the roof and regional labor rates.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as roof removal, insulation, or rep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 or more to the project. These costs depend on the existing roof condition and specific project requirements. Local contractors can assess and provide estimates for these extra services.
Overall Project Cost - The total cost for sheet roofing installation typically ranges from $7,000 to $20,000 for an average residential roof. Variations depend on materials, roof size, and project complexity. Consulting local pros helps obtain accurate, customized c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
